Ambalapattu North - Orathanadu, Thanjavur
Ambalapattu North is a village situated in the Orathanadu taluka of Thanjavur district, Tamil Nadu. It is located approximately 11 km from the tehsil headquarters in Orathanadu and around 31 km from the district headquarters in Thanjavur. Ambalapattu North village is a designated Gram Panchayat.
As per Census 2011, the village code of Ambalapattu North is 638944. The village covers a total geographical area of 726.32 hectares and falls under the 614626 pincode. Orathanadu is the nearest town.
Ambalapattu North village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Orattanadu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Thanjavur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.
Population of Ambalapattu North
As per Census 2011, Ambalapattu North village has a total population of 3,554 people, consisting of 1,628 males and 1,926 females. The village has 952 households and a sex ratio of 1,183 females per 1,000 males. There are 332 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 2,471 literate and 1,083 illiterate residents. Additionally, 544 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ities.
Detailed gender-wise population figures for Ambalapattu North are given below:
| Category | Total | Male | Female |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Population | 3,554 | 1,628 | 1,926 |
|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 332 | 171 | 161 |
| Scheduled Castes (SC) | 544 | 266 | 278 |
| Literate Population | 2,471 | 1,263 | 1,208 |
| Illiterate Population | 1,083 | 365 | 718 |

Transport and Connectivity of Ambalapattu North
Public transport in the Ambalapattu North is mainly available through bus services.
| Connectivity |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Public Bus Service | Yes | Available within village |
| Private Bus Service | Yes | Available within village |
| Railway Station | No | - |
In addition to basic transport facilities, distances and travel times help define overall connectivity. the road distance from Thanjavur to Ambalapattu North is about 31 km, with the usual travel time around 1-1.25 hours.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
Banking and Postal Services in Ambalapattu North
Banking and postal services are essential for daily financial transactions and communication. The availability of these facilities for Ambalapattu North village is detailed below:
| Service Type |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Bank | No | Available within >10 km |
| ATM | No | Available within 5-10 km |
| Post Office | No | Available within >10 km |
Health Facilities in Ambalapattu North
Healthcare facilities play an important role in providing basic medical services to the residents. The details regarding the nearest health centres and hospitals serving Ambalapattu North village are given below:
| Facility Type |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Health Sub-Centre (HSC) | Yes | Available within village |
| Primary Health Centre (PHC) | Yes | Available within village |
| Community Health Centre (CHC) | Yes | Available within village |
